ob Title: US-Canada Gulf Export Logistics & Freight Forwarding Specialist
Location:Bangalore JP nagar
Shift: US Shifts (Night Shift as per US Time Zones)
Employment Type: Full-Time
Job Summary:
We are seeking an experienced Logistics & Freight Forwarding Specialist with expertise in handling US-Canada Gulf exports.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in freight forwarding, cargo handling, and export logistics. This role requires working in US shifts and managing key operations related to sea perishables and general freight movement between the US and Canada.
Key Responsibilities:
- Oversee and manage end-to-end export operations for US-Canada Gulf shipments.
- Coordinate with shipping lines, freight forwarders, and customs brokers to ensure seamless cargo movement.
- Handle documentation including Bill of Lading (BOL), commercial invoices, packing lists, export declarations, and customs paperwork.
- Monitor and track shipments to ensure timely delivery and resolve any logistical challenges.
- Work closely with clients, vendors, and internal teams to provide excellent customer service.
- Ensure compliance with US and Canadian trade regulations, customs laws, and export control policies.
- Manage rate negotiations with carriers and third-party logistics providers to optimize cost and efficiency.
- Prepare and analyze reports related to shipment performance, cost, and efficiency.
- Address and resolve any issues related to documentation discrepancies, delays, or carrier coordination.
Required Qualifications & Skills:
- 3+ years of experience in logistics, freight forwarding, or export operations.
- Strong knowledge of US-Canada trade routes, Gulf export procedures, and customs regulations.
- Experience handling sea perishables and general freight shipments is a plus.
- Proficiency in using freight management systems, ERP tools, and Microsoft Office Suite.
- Excellent communication skills to coordinate with stakeholders across different time zones.
- Ability to work in US shifts (Night Shift as per US Time Zones).
- Strong problem-solving skills and ability to handle urgent shipment-related issues.
- Attention to detail in documentation and compliance procedures.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ience working with freight forwarding companies, shipping lines, or logistics service providers.
- Certification in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, or International Trade is an advantage.
- Familiarity with Canadian customs clearance processes and NAFTA/USMCA trade agreements.
